Advertisement
Guest User

Untitled

a guest
Jan 19th, 2017
95
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Bash 0.38 KB | None | 0 0
  1. mc_test () {
  2.  
  3. local retry_flag="$2"
  4. local retry=0
  5. local mc_error=""
  6.  
  7. for (( retry; retry<10; retry+=1 )); do
  8.  
  9.   echo "call mc_test"
  10.   mc_error=$(grep -w "ERROR" ~/minicom.log)
  11.  
  12.   if  [ -n "$mc_error" ] && [ -z "$retry_flag" ]; then
  13.     break
  14.   else
  15.     echo "try again"
  16.   fi
  17.  
  18. done
  19.  
  20. echo "retry_flasg=$retry_flag"
  21. echo $mc_error
  22.  
  23. }
  24.  
  25.  
  26. mc_test test_1 r
  27. #mc_test
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ement